Oil States International, Inc. Common Stock — Fundamental Analysis Summary
Oil States International, Inc. Common Stock (OIS) is currently trading 57% above its Graham Number of $5.64, suggesting the market price exceeds Benjamin Graham's intrinsic value estimate. The stock carries an elevated trailing P/E ratio of 59.3x.
On financial health, OIS shows a strong Piotroski F-Score of 7/9, indicating improving fundamentals across profitability, leverage, and efficiency, and modest return on equity of 1.6% (sector average: 4.9%), and minimal leverage with a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.00.
StockPik's composite Value Score for OIS is 85/100 — placing it in undervalued territory. The score is built from ten fundamental signals: P/E, P/B, PEG ratio, P/S ratio, return on equity, gross margin, debt-to-equity, current ratio, dividend yield, and Piotroski F-Score.
OIS reports a moderate gross margin of 23.2% (sector average: 46.3%) and a modest operating margin of 3.1%.
OIS shows revenue declining at 3% year-over-year, with earnings declining at 872%.
